Why Smart Homeowners in Los Altos Are Upgrading Their Security

Los Altos may be one of Silicon Valley’s safest communities, but safety is never something to take for granted. I’ve seen homeowners overlook small vulnerabilities—like side gates that don’t latch properly or old motion sensors that no longer pick up activity—until a close call wakes them up.

From my experience, there are three main reasons families in this area invest in upgraded systems:

1. Larger Homes Need More Comprehensive Coverage

Many Los Altos homes include multiple entry points—glass doors, backyard patios, upper-floor balconies, and garage side doors. A basic alarm system simply isn’t enough. You need layered protection: motion sensors, perimeter alarms, smart video surveillance, and remote monitoring.

2. Busy Lifestyles Demand Convenience

Most residents juggle demanding work schedules, frequent travel, or long commutes. They need systems that work without constant maintenance—automated arming, smartphone alerts, and 24/7 monitoring give that peace of mind when no one’s home.

3. Tech-Savvy Living Means Smarter Threats

The Bay Area sees its share of digital vulnerabilities too. Modern intruders sometimes exploit Wi-Fi-connected devices, outdated firmware, or unprotected smart locks. This is where hi-tech security services in Los Altos make all the difference—systems are encrypted, cloud-based, and secure.

Real Examples: What Security Looks Like in Everyday Los Altos Homes

To make this more tangible, here are a few situations I’ve seen firsthand:

A Family Near Grant Park

They had a traditional alarm system but kept getting false alerts. We upgraded them to AI-powered motion cameras that distinguish between pets, people, and vehicles. Not only did the false alarms stop, but they were able to track package deliveries more accurately.

A Tech Executive Living Near Downtown

He traveled often and needed complete remote control over his home. With a hi-tech access control system, he could lock doors, review camera footage, and receive alerts from anywhere in the world—perfect for his schedule.

A Retired Couple in North Los Altos

They wanted security without the complexity. We installed a simple interface with smart sensors and automated lighting that activates at sunset. Their home feels safer than ever, and the system doesn’t overwhelm them.

These examples show that home security should adapt to the homeowner, not the other way around.

What Modern Home Security Services Include

Today’s solutions go far beyond the old-school “beep-beep” alarm. When people invest in home security services in Los Altos, here are the components they usually prioritize:

Smart Video Surveillance

HD cameras with night vision, wide-angle coverage, and real-time notifications allow you to monitor your property from anywhere.

Access Control

This includes smart locks, keyless entry, and visitor management—ideal for families with kids or frequent guests.

Environmental Sensors

Smoke, CO2, water leaks, and temperature sensors help prevent costly property damage, especially in larger homes.

Perimeter Security

Gate alarms, outdoor beams, and smart lighting deter intruders before they even reach your doors.

Professional Monitoring

Trained security specialists keep watch around the clock, ensuring fast response times and added protection when you’re away.

FAQ

  1. Do I really need professional monitoring if I already have cameras?
    Yes. Cameras are reactive; monitoring is proactive. Professionals can respond instantly—even when you’re asleep or traveling.
  2. Can smart home devices work with my security system?
    Most modern systems integrate seamlessly with devices like Alexa, Google Nest, or Ring.
  3. Are hi-tech systems difficult to manage?
    Not at all. The best setups are designed to be user-friendly, even for non-tech-savvy homeowners.
